查看单个帖子
旧 2005-01-31   #19
bingwu
正式会员
级别:1 | 在线时长:14小时 | 升级还需:1小时
 
bingwu 的头像
 
注册: 04年11月28日
帖子: 5
声望力: 0
声望: 20 bingwu 初领妙道
现金:14两梁山币
资产:14两梁山币
致谢数: 0
获感谢文章数:0
获会员感谢数:0
回复: 问个bt的问题

转贴看到的一个公式:

现在介绍使用法术攻击的成功率:
1:公式:
攻击者:
a = (enable spells levle)^3/10 (如有效法术100级,a=100*100*100/10=100000 )
b = a*(1+(daoxing)/500000) (如道行500年,b=a*(1+(500*1000)/500000) )
c = b+ (daoxing) (如道行500年,c=b+500*1000 )
d = c*success_adj/100 (如用大力降魔杵,d=c*150/100 )
受攻击者:
te = target(daoxing)+target(武学)/3
(如受攻击者道行500年,武学1000000,te=500*1000+1000000)
武学高也可以增加防被法术击中的概率,没想到吧。。。嘿嘿。。。
再考虑法术相克:
假如攻击者所用法术克被攻击者:
te = te / 5
假如被攻击者法术克攻击者:
d = d / 5
假如互不相克,te 和 d 保持原数值。
then
if {random(100)>[te*100/(te+d)]}
success=1
bingwu 当前离线  
回复时引用此帖